Fig. 2: Experimental results obtained with the KRAKEN protocol in the case of photoionization of helium atoms.

a, Photoelectron spectrograms are acquired for different values of δω (from left to right: ℏδω = 0, 41, 61, 80, 98, 117, 134 meV). b, Energy-resolved oscillation amplitude Aδω for the different spectrograms. The shaded area indicates the uncertainty of the fit (1 s.d.; Supplementary Discussion 2). c, The density matrix obtained by inserting the oscillation amplitudes for each δω at the corresponding position in an initially empty density matrix. The dark blue areas correspond to regions of the density matrix that are not reconstructed.
